What Is RAID and Why Do Businesses Use It?
RAID stands for Redundant Array of Independent Disks. It is a storage technology that combines multiple hard drives or SSDs into a single system so they can work together to store and protect data. RAID is commonly used in business servers, network storage systems (NAS), and backup environments because it improves performance, increases storage capacity, and provides data redundancy.

Instead of storing data on one single drive, RAID spreads data across multiple drives. This means if one drive fails, the system may still continue running depending on the RAID level being used. This is why many businesses rely on RAID systems to keep their operations running and reduce the risk of data loss.
Businesses use RAID systems for several reasons:
- Store large amounts of business data
- Improve storage performance and speed
- Protect data from single drive failure
- Keep servers and systems running without interruption
- Store backups and shared company files
- Improve overall system reliability
- Reduce downtime if a drive fails
- Support business applications and databases
There are different RAID configurations such as RAID 0, RAID 1, RAID 5, and RAID 10, and each type stores data in a different way. Some RAID setups are designed mainly for performance, while others are designed for data protection and redundancy. Businesses usually choose a RAID setup based on their storage needs, performance requirements, and level of data protection required.
Even though RAID systems provide protection and redundancy, they are not a full backup solution. RAID can protect against a single drive failure, but it cannot protect against accidental deletion, virus attacks, file corruption, or multiple drive failures. This is why businesses should always use RAID together with proper backup systems to fully protect their important data.
Why RAID Systems Fail and Cause Data Loss
Many people believe RAID systems cannot fail, but RAID failures are actually common, especially in business environments where servers run continuously.
Common causes of RAID failure include:
- Multiple drive failures
- RAID controller failure
- Power surge or sudden shutdown
- RAID configuration corruption
- Human error during rebuild
- Accidental deletion of data
- Virus or malware attacks
- Server overheating
- Firmware corruption
- File system corruption
In many cases, the RAID system itself fails, not just one drive. This makes RAID data recovery more complex and requires a data recovery specialist.

How Professional RAID Data Recovery Works
Professional RAID Data Recovery Calgary involves a careful and structured process to recover data from failed RAID systems without damaging the drives further.
The RAID recovery process usually includes:
- RAID diagnostics and failure analysis
- Checking RAID configuration and drive order
- Creating sector-by-sector images of each drive
- Rebuilding RAID array virtually
- Repairing corrupted file systems
- Extracting recoverable data
- Testing recovered files
- Copying recovered data to a new storage device
Professional recovery equipment allows technicians to rebuild RAID arrays even when the server does not recognize the system or when multiple drives have failed.

How Businesses Can Prevent RAID Data Loss
Even though RAID provides redundancy, businesses should still have proper backup systems to prevent data loss.
Here are some tips to prevent RAID data loss:
- Always maintain external backups
- Use cloud backup solutions
- Monitor RAID health regularly
- Replace failing drives immediately
- Use surge protectors and UPS systems
- Keep servers properly cooled
- Do not ignore RAID warnings
- Schedule regular server maintenance
- Test backups regularly
RAID is not a backup system. Backup and RAID should always be used together for data protection.
